Default Dialogue enhancement

My Pioneer VSX-517 has a dialogue enhancement setting. When off all the dialog comes from the center. When on it is mixed across all the fronts.

What is best, on or off?

I have never heard a set up like yours. If you have a weak center speaker then go with the enhancement and have it come from all front speakers. If you have a strong center speaker then I suggest not using the enhancement because I prefer to listen to the movie the way the studio intended. It is all personal preference though. Go with what you think sounds best.
